前端开发是一个日新月异的领域,不断涌现出各种令人眼花缭乱的工具和框架。在这篇博客中,我将介绍一些我认为最实用的前端工具和框架,希望能对您的开发工作有所帮助。
工具
1. Visual Studio Code
Visual Studio Code是一款免费且强大的源代码编辑器,具备智能代码补全、调试等功能。它支持各种编程语言,并提供了丰富的插件生态系统,可以根据个人需求进行扩展。无论是编写HTML、CSS、JavaScript还是其他语言,Visual Studio Code都是绝佳选择。
2. Git
Git是目前最流行的版本控制系统,不仅能够帮助团队协作开发,还能追踪项目的改动和管理历史版本。通过使用Git,您可以轻松地将项目托管到GitHub或其他远程仓库,与团队成员共享代码,并保持代码的安全和一致性。
3. Chrome开发者工具
Chrome开发者工具是现代前端开发的必备工具之一。它提供了丰富的调试和分析功能,可以帮助您查看和修改HTML、CSS和JavaScript代码,并模拟不同的设备和网络条件。通过使用Chrome开发者工具,您可以更高效地调试和优化您的网站或应用程序。
4. Webpack
Webpack是一个强大的模块打包工具,可以将多个前端资源(如JavaScript、CSS、图片等)打包成一个或多个静态文件。它通过模块的依赖关系自动构建资源,还提供了一些优化功能,例如压缩代码、代码分割等。Webpack极大地简化了前端开发的工作流程,并提高了网页的加载速度。
5. ESLint
ESLint是一个JavaScript代码规范和错误检查工具,可以帮助您确保代码质量和一致性。它提供了一系列的规则和插件,可以在编码过程中检查语法错误、潜在的问题和不推荐的写法。通过使用ESLint,您可以提高代码的可读性和可维护性,并减少潜在的bug。
框架
1. React
React是一个用于构建用户界面的JavaScript库,由Facebook开发和维护。它采用了组件化的开发模式,使得开发者可以将UI拆分成独立的组件,提高了代码的复用性和可维护性。React还支持虚拟DOM机制,提高了渲染性能,同时具备强大的生态系统,包括React Router和Redux等扩展库。
2. Vue.js
Vue.js是一个轻量级的JavaScript框架,用于构建交互式的Web界面。它采用了响应式数据绑定和组件化开发的思想,使得开发者可以轻松地构建复杂的应用程序。Vue.js具有简单易学、高效灵活和友好的生态系统等特点,成为了很多开发者的首选框架。
3. Angular
Angular是一个用于构建Web应用程序的开发平台,由Google开发和维护。它采用了声明式的HTML模板和组件化的开发模式,可以帮助开发者快速构建高质量的应用程序。Angular具有强大的功能和良好的可扩展性,适合构建大型和复杂的前端项目。
4. Bootstrap
Bootstrap是一个流行的开源前端框架,用于构建响应式、移动优先的Web项目。它提供了丰富的CSS和JavaScript组件,可用于快速搭建美观和用户友好的界面。Bootstrap具有易用性、可定制性和良好的浏览器兼容性等特点,是许多前端开发者的首选框架。
5. Express
Express是一个简单而灵活的Node.js Web应用程序框架,用于构建可扩展和易于维护的Web应用程序。它提供了一套强大的API,用于处理HTTP请求、路由和中间件等。通过使用Express,您可以快速搭建基于Node.js的Web项目,并提供出色的性能和可靠性。
以上是我个人认为最实用的前端工具和框架,它们能够极大地提高开发效率和代码质量。希望这些工具和框架能够对您的前端开发工作有所帮助!
本文来自极简博客,作者:闪耀之星喵,转载请注明原文链接:实用的前端工具和框架大揭秘